Full Job Description

Supply Chain Management Analyst Company: The Boeing Company The P8 Value Stream Integration Supply Chain team is seeking an experienced SCMA (Level 4) to manage and support emergent part demand requests from P8 Wings, Final Assembly, Preflight, and BDS. The role requires full-time onsite presence in Renton, WA. Key Responsibilities: Manage emergent part demand requests, including dropping parts in PDM, adding parts to ERP contracts, and releasing purchase orders to support second issue requirements (assemblies or POAs). Develop and improve processes using data analytics to enhance the P8 Supply Chain teams performance. Identify and resolve daily part or supply chain issues to support program stakeholders. Serve as the interface between Supply Chain Contracts, Supply Chain Operations, and P8 Program stakeholders. Communicate and coordinate part/POA status with P8 Manufacturing, Leadership, and Supply Chain partners. Utilize expert knowledge of Microsoft Excel, Tableau/web-based tools, and basic proficiency in Microsoft Access (experience with ERPMART is a plus). Oversee emergent process flow from requirement notification through part delivery and issuance to the shop floor/airplane. Apply advanced knowledge of ordering and scheduling within the ERPLN system, leveraging data from multiple sources to make informed part ordering decisions. Demonstrate excellent communication, organization, time management, and problem-solving skills. Build positive working relationships through partnership and collaboration. Work independently with a strong bias for action and the ability to thrive in a fast-paced, autonomous environment. Negotiate effectively with stakeholders to achieve mutually acceptable outcomes. Utilize critical thinking to proactively troubleshoot and escalate issues appropriately, understanding the impact of decisions across departments. Understand cross-departmental interactions and their impact on non-procurement processes (e.g., Engineering, Business, Operations, Logistics). Be knowledgeable of customer and supplier requirements to support program production schedules and airplane deliveries for both planned and unplanned demand. Shift: Multiple shifts, primarily 1st shift (flexible cross-shift coverage including 2nd shift and weekend overtime on a rotational basis) Basic Qualifications: 5+ years of Procurement/Supply Chain experience. 5+ years of experience with supply chain concepts, material requirements planning, procurement policies, and processes. Strong understanding of business operations and ability to navigate formal and informal organizational channels. 5+ years of experience with Microsoft Excel, Tableau/web-based tools, and basic proficiency in Microsoft Access (ERPMART experience is a plus). 5+ years of experience in data analytics. Preferred Qualifications: 5+ years of experience with procurement systems (ERPLN, SAT, PAVE) and program systems (CMES, SAT, MPR), including querying system data tables (Datamart). Advanced skills in Excel and Tableau, capable of performing comprehensive data analysis and translating findings into executive summaries. Experience working with Defense programs and familiarity with DFARS requirements. Education: Bachelors degree or higher with typically 6+ years of related work experience, or an equivalent combination of education and experience (e.g., Masters + 4 years, 10 years experience, etc.).
